Altogether the league comprises 56 teams in 9 Canadian provinces and 5 American states. For lists of teams see the articles about each member league.

The CHL awards the Memorial Cup to the Canadian junior hockey champion (the American members also compete for this trophy). It is the chief development league for the National Hockey League. More than half the players in the National Hockey League for the 2002-2003 season had played in the CHL.
